D.H. Machine is a northern-Indiana based machine shop that provides a number of metal fabrication services such as welding, manufacturing steel and aluminum products, powder coating, bending (brake press), laser cutting, plasma cutting, and large commercial framework assembly. We are working hard to equip local businesses to change the world. We are doing that by building a community of local business leaders who want to be inspired, grow, and learn. As a machine shop, we serve a variety of industries such as tractor attachment manufacturing, construction and engineering, aerospace, and more. Over the last 30 years, DHM has developed a reputation of reliability in the industrial heartland of northern Indiana. While we are dedicated to quality service to our community businesses, we also enjoy serving clients throughout the United States. We operate state-of-the-art equipment, including: - Seven brake presses capable of bending metal ranging from 8’-14’ in length and force capacities ranging from 55-600 tons. Our largest machine is capable of bending three inches of hardened steel. - Plasma Cutters including a 12’x60’ Alltra HG16 with Hypertherm XPR300-VWI Plasma System - True hole technology that eliminates hole taper, has best top and bottom level roundness, and narrows gap with laser cutter hole quality. Our gas combination produces quality cuts on all metals, and performs well on non-ferrous aluminum and stainless steel. Our machines maintain precision cuts on up to three inch thick material. - Powder coating setup that can process thousands of small units and hundreds of large units (40”x40”x8’) daily. Our machines operate continuously throughout the day, and can work with all varieties of powder coating that will cover the wide ranges of quality, finish, and color–all based on our client’s preference and budget.
